Abstract

The Path Computation Element Communication Protocol (PCEP) allows PathComputation Clients (PCCs) to request path computations from PathComputation Elements (PCEs), and lets the PCEs return responses. Whencomputing or reoptimizing the routes of a set of Traffic EngineeringLabel Switched Paths (TE LSPs) through a network, it may beadvantageous to perform bulk path computations in order to avoidblocking problems and to achieve more optimal network-wide solutions.Such bulk optimization is termed Global Concurrent Optimization (GCO).A GCO is able to simultaneously consider the entire topology of thenetwork and the complete set of existing TE LSPs, and their respectiveconstraints, and look to optimize or reoptimize the entire network tosatisfy all constraints for all TE LSPs. A GCO may also be applied tosome subset of the TE LSPs in a network. The GCO application isprimarily a Network Management System (NMS) solution.

This document provides application-specific requirements and the PCEPextensions in support of GCO applications. [STANDARDS-TRACK]
